What Is First Order Logic First-order logic is a collection of formal systems that are utilized in the fields of mathematics, philosophy, linguistics, and computer science. Other names for first-order logic include predicate logic, quantificational logic, and first-order predicate calculus. In first-order logic, quantified variables take precedence over non-logical objects, and the use of sentences that contain variables is permitted. As a result, rather than making assertions like "Socrates is a man," one can make statements of the form "there exists x such that x is Socrates and x is a man," where "there exists" is a quantifier and "x" is a variable. This is in contrast to propositional logic, which does not make use of quantifiers or relations; propositional logic serves as the basis for first-order logic in this sense. The evaluation of a logical formula can be viewed as a game played by two opponents, one trying to show that the formula is true and the other trying to prove it is false. This correspondence has been known for a very long time and has inspired numerous research directions. In this book, the author extends this connection between logic and games to the class of automatic structures, where relations are recognized by synchronous finite automata. In model-checking games for automatic structures, two coalitions play against each other with a particular kind of hierarchical imperfect information. The investigation of such games leads to the introduction of a game quantifier on automatic structures, which connects alternating automata with the classical model-theoretic notion of a game quantifier. This study is then extended, determining the memory needed for strategies in infinitary games on the one hand, and characterizing regularity-preserving Lindström quantifiers on the other. Counting quantifiers are investigated in depth: it is shown that all countable omega-automatic structures are in fact finite-word automatic and that the infinity and uncountability set quantifiers are definable in MSO over countable linear orders and over labeled binary trees. Recent years have seen an explosion of interest in evolutionary debunking arguments directed against certain types of belief, particularly moral and religious beliefs. According to those arguments, the evolutionary origins of the cognitive mechanisms that produce the targeted beliefs render these beliefs epistemically unjustified. The reason is that natural selection cares for reproduction and survival rather than truth, and false beliefs can in principle be as evolutionarily advantageous as true beliefs.
